Government Inspection History

18 inspection visits in the last three years, 87 citations on file. Inspections are conducted by state agencies on behalf of the U.S.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S).

Source: CMS Care Compare, public federal data covering certified nursing facilities, refreshed monthly. Citations range from A (least serious) to L (most serious) on the federal scope and severity scale.
